2117. [bug] DNSSEC fixes: named could fail to cache NSEC records

                        which could lead to validation failures.  named didn't
                        handle negative DS responses that were in the process
                        of being validated.  Check CNAME bit before accepting
                        NODATA proof. To be able to ignore a child NSEC there
                        must be SOA (and NS) set in the bitmap. [RT #16399]
